A modern informatikai infrastruktúra működésében a megbízhatóság és a folyamatos rendelkezésre állás alapvető követelmény. Amikor kritikus alkalmazásokról vagy szolgáltatásokról van szó, egyetlen pont meghibásodása sem engedhető meg. A klaszter technológiák pontosan ezt a kihívást hivatottak megoldani, biztosítva a szolgáltatások zavartalan működését még hardver- vagy szoftverhibák esetén is.
A klaszter quorum disk koncepciója egy speciális megközelítést képvisel a megosztott tárolás és a döntéshozatal területén. Ez a technológia lehetővé teszi, hogy több szerver együttműködve működjön, miközben közös döntéseket hoz a működésről és az erőforrások kezeléséről. A quorum mechanizmus különböző formái léteznek, és mindegyik más-más előnyöket kínál a különféle környezetekben.
Az alábbiakban részletesen megvizsgáljuk ezt a komplex technológiát, feltárva működési elveit, gyakorlati alkalmazásait és a megvalósítás során felmerülő kihívásokat. Megismerjük a különböző quorum típusokat, azok konfigurációs lehetőségeit, valamint azt, hogyan választhatjuk ki a legmegfelelőbb megoldást adott környezetünkben.
A Quorum Koncepció Alapjai
A quorum fogalma eredetileg a politikai döntéshozatalból származik, ahol a határozatképességhez szükséges minimális létszámot jelöli. Az informatikában ez a koncepció a klaszter csomópontok közötti döntéshozatali mechanizmust írja le.
A klaszter környezetben a quorum biztosítja, hogy csak azok a csomópontok folytathassák a működést, amelyek képesek kommunikálni egymással és megfelelő számban vannak jelen. Ez megakadályozza a "split-brain" szituációt, amikor a klaszter különböző részei egymástól függetlenül próbálnak működni.
A quorum disk ebben a rendszerben egy külön tárolóeszköz szerepét tölti be, amely döntő szavazatként funkcionál a klaszter működésével kapcsolatos kérdésekben. Ez különösen fontos két csomópontos klaszterekben, ahol a hagyományos többségi szavazás nem alkalmazható.
Quorum Típusok és Működési Mechanizmusok
Node Majority Quorum
A csomópont többségi quorum a legegyszerűbb forma, ahol a klaszter akkor működik tovább, ha a csomópontok több mint fele elérhető és működőképes. Ez ideális megoldás páratlan számú csomóponttal rendelkező klaszterek esetében.
A működés során minden aktív csomópont egy szavazattal rendelkezik. A klaszter akkor marad online, ha a szavazatok száma meghaladja a teljes csomópontszám felét. Ez automatikusan megakadályozza a párhuzamos működést.
Node and Disk Majority
Ez a konfiguráció kombinálja a csomópontok szavazatait egy megosztott tárolóeszköz szavazatával. A quorum disk ebben az esetben további biztonsági réteget nyújt, különösen akkor hasznos, ha páros számú csomópontunk van.
| Quorum Típus | Csomópontok | Disk | Előnyök | Hátrányok |
|---|---|---|---|---|
| Node Majority | 3+ (páratlan) | Nem szükséges | Egyszerű konfiguráció | Páros csomópontszámnál problémás |
| Node and Disk | 2+ (bármilyen) | Szükséges | Rugalmas, páros csomópontszámnál is működik | Külön tárolóeszköz szükséges |
| Disk Only | 2+ | Szükséges | Minimális hálózati forgalom | Tárolófüggőség |
Disk Only Quorum
A csak lemez alapú quorum esetében a döntéshozatal kizárólag a megosztott tárolóeszköz elérhetőségén alapul. Ez a megoldás különösen hasznos olyan környezetekben, ahol a hálózati kapcsolat instabil lehet.
Quorum Disk Implementációs Stratégiák
Tárolótechnológiai Megfontolások
A quorum disk megvalósítása során kritikus fontosságú a megfelelő tárolótechnológia kiválasztása. A magas rendelkezésre állás érdekében redundáns tárolórendszereket kell alkalmazni, amelyek saját maguk is hibatűrőek.
A SAN (Storage Area Network) környezetek ideális platformot nyújtanak a quorum diskek számára. Az FC (Fibre Channel) vagy iSCSI alapú megoldások egyaránt alkalmasak, feltéve hogy megfelelő redundanciával rendelkeznek. A tárolórendszer teljesítménye kevésbé kritikus, mivel a quorum műveletek általában kis adatmennyiséggel dolgoznak.
Az aszinkron replikáció használata lehetővé teszi a quorum disk földrajzilag távoli helyre történő másolását. Ez különösen fontos katasztrófa-helyreállítási forgatókönyvekben, ahol a teljes adatközpont elérhetetlenné válhat.
Hálózati Architektúra Tervezése
A quorum disk elérése szempontjából a hálózati kapcsolatok megbízhatósága elsődleges szempont. Többszörös útvonalak kialakítása biztosítja, hogy egyetlen hálózati komponens meghibásodása ne akadályozza a quorum működését.
A MPIO (Multipath I/O) konfiguráció lehetővé teszi több független útvonal használatát ugyanazon tárolóeszköz eléréséhez. Ez nemcsak a megbízhatóságot növeli, hanem terheléselosztást is biztosít a különböző kapcsolatok között.
Konfigurációs Lehetőségek és Beállítások
Windows Server Failover Clustering
A Microsoft Windows Server környezetben a quorum konfigurációja a Failover Cluster Manager segítségével történik. A rendszer automatikusan ajánl quorum konfigurációt a klaszter topológiája alapján, de ez testre szabható a konkrét igények szerint.
A dinamikus quorum funkció lehetővé teszi, hogy a rendszer automatikusan módosítsa a quorum beállításokat a klaszter állapotának változásai alapján. Ez különösen hasznos olyan helyzetekben, amikor csomópontok kiesnek vagy visszatérnek a klaszterbe.
A witness disk mérete általában kis lehet, mivel csak metaadatokat tárol. Jellemzően 512 MB – 1 GB közötti méret elegendő a legtöbb környezetben. Fontos azonban, hogy a disk gyors legyen és alacsony késleltetést biztosítson.
Linux Klaszter Megoldások
A Linux környezetben számos klaszter megoldás támogatja a quorum disk használatát. A Pacemaker és Corosync kombinációja népszerű választás, amely rugalmas quorum konfigurációs lehetőségeket kínál.
Az OCFS2 (Oracle Cluster File System) és a GFS2 (Global File System) egyaránt támogatja a megosztott tárolást klaszter környezetben. Ezek a fájlrendszerek beépített quorum mechanizmusokkal rendelkeznek, amelyek integrálódnak a klaszter menedzsment szoftverrel.
Teljesítmény és Optimalizálás
I/O Minták és Optimalizálás
A quorum disk I/O mintái általában kis, véletlenszerű írási műveletekből állnak. Ez különbözik a hagyományos alkalmazás adatbázisok mintáitól, ezért specifikus optimalizálási stratégiákat igényel.
Az írási cache beállítások kritikus fontosságúak a quorum disk esetében. Míg a teljesítmény szempontjából a cache előnyös lehet, az adatintegritás érdekében gyakran ki kell kapcsolni vagy speciálisan konfigurálni kell.
A tárolórendszer szintjén alkalmazott tükrözés vagy RAID konfiguráció biztosítja a redundanciát. A RAID 1 (tükrözés) általában elegendő, mivel a quorum disk nem igényel nagy tárolókapacitást, de maximális megbízhatóságot kell nyújtania.
| Paraméter | Ajánlott Érték | Indoklás |
|---|---|---|
| Disk méret | 512 MB – 1 GB | Csak metaadatok tárolása |
| RAID szint | RAID 1 vagy 10 | Maximális redundancia |
| Cache beállítás | Write-through vagy kikapcsolva | Adatintegritás biztosítása |
| Hálózati kapcsolat | Minimum 2 független útvonal | Hibatűrés növelése |
Monitoring és Diagnosztika
A quorum disk állapotának folyamatos monitorozása elengedhetetlen a klaszter megbízható működéséhez. Speciális figyelmet kell fordítani a tárolóeszköz válaszidejére, az I/O hibákra és a hálózati kapcsolatok állapotára.
Az eseménynaplók rendszeres elemzése segít azonosítani a potenciális problémákat még azelőtt, hogy azok befolyásolnák a klaszter működését. A proaktív monitoring lehetővé teszi a megelőző karbantartás ütemezését és a hibák korai felismerését.
Hibakezelés és Helyreállítási Eljárások
Gyakori Hibascenáriók
A quorum disk hibái különböző formákat ölthetnek, a teljes tárolóeszköz kiesésétől kezdve az időszakos kapcsolati problémákig. Minden hibatípus különböző kezelési stratégiát igényel.
Tárolóeszköz teljes kiesése esetén a klaszter működése a konfigurált quorum típustól függően folytatódhat vagy leállhat. A gyors helyreállítás érdekében előre elkészített helyettesítő diskekkel és automatizált helyreállítási eljárásokkal kell rendelkezni.
A hálózati kapcsolati problémák gyakran időszakos természetűek, de jelentős hatással lehetnek a klaszter stabilitására. A timeout értékek megfelelő beállítása segít megkülönböztetni az átmeneti problémákat a valódi hibáktól.
Helyreállítási Stratégiák
A quorum disk helyreállítása során kritikus fontosságú a helyes sorrend betartása. Először a tárolórendszer integritását kell helyreállítani, majd a klaszter szolgáltatásokat lehet újraindítani.
Az adatintegritás ellenőrzése minden helyreállítási folyamat első lépése kell legyen. A sérült quorum adatok helyreállítása speciális eszközöket és eljárásokat igényel, amelyeket előre ki kell dolgozni és tesztelni kell.
A backup és restore eljárások a quorum disk esetében különösen fontosak, mivel a sérült quorum adatok az egész klaszter működését veszélyeztethetik. Rendszeres biztonsági mentések és a helyreállítási eljárások tesztelése elengedhetetlen.
Biztonsági Szempontok
Hozzáférés Vezérlés
A quorum disk biztonsága kritikus fontosságú a klaszter integritása szempontjából. Szigorú hozzáférés-vezérlés alkalmazása megakadályozza az illetéktelen módosításokat és a potenciális biztonsági incidenseket.
A tárolószintű titkosítás további védelmet nyújt az adatok ellen. Ez különösen fontos olyan környezetekben, ahol a tárolóeszközök fizikai biztonsága nem garantált teljes mértékben.
A hálózati forgalom titkosítása szintén fontos szempont, különösen akkor, ha a quorum disk távoli helyen található. Az IPSec vagy más VPN technológiák használata biztosítja a kommunikáció biztonságát.
Auditálás és Naplózás
A quorum diskhez kapcsolódó összes művelet naplózása elengedhetetlen a biztonsági incidensek nyomon követéséhez és a megfelelőségi követelmények teljesítéséhez. A részletes naplók segítik a hibakeresést és a rendszergazdák munkáját.
Az automatizált riasztási rendszerek beállítása lehetővé teszi a gyors reagálást a biztonsági eseményekre. Ez magában foglalja a szokatlan hozzáférési mintákat, a sikertelen authentikációs kísérleteket és a konfiguráció módosításokat.
Kapacitástervezés és Skálázhatóság
Növekedési Tervezés
A quorum disk kapacitásigénye általában stabil marad a klaszter méretének növekedésével, mivel csak a klaszter metaadatait tárolja. Azonban a teljesítményigények növekedhetnek több csomópont esetén.
A jövőbeli bővítések tervezése során figyelembe kell venni a potenciális klaszter topológia változásokat és az új technológiai követelményeket. Ez magában foglalja a tárolórendszer skálázhatóságát és a hálózati infrastruktúra kapacitását.
A földrajzilag elosztott klaszterek esetében a quorum disk elhelyezése stratégiai döntést igényel. A késleltetés és a rendelkezésre állás közötti egyensúly megtalálása kritikus fontosságú a megfelelő működés érdekében.
Költségoptimalizálás
A quorum disk implementáció költségei optimalizálhatók a megfelelő tárolótechnológia kiválasztásával. Míg a megbízhatóság nem kompromittálható, a teljesítményigények általában mérsékeltek, ami lehetőséget ad költséghatékony megoldások alkalmazására.
A megosztott tárolóinfrastruktúra használata több klaszter között csökkentheti az összes költséget. Ez különösen hatékony nagy szervezetek esetében, ahol több független klaszter működik.
"A quorum disk nem csak egy tárolóeszköz, hanem a klaszter döntéshozatali mechanizmusának alapköve, amely meghatározza a teljes rendszer megbízhatóságát."
"A megfelelően konfigurált quorum mechanizmus a különbség a stabil és az instabil klaszter működés között, különösen kritikus alkalmazások esetében."
"A quorum disk hibája nem feltétlenül jelenti a teljes rendszer leállását, de mindig azonnali beavatkozást igényel a szolgáltatás kontinuitás biztosítása érdekében."
"A modern klaszter technológiákban a quorum disk szerepe egyre komplexebbé válik, de alapvető fontossága változatlan marad."
"A proaktív monitoring és a megfelelő hibakezelési eljárások a quorum disk menedzsment sikerének kulcsfontosságú elemei."
Jövőbeli Technológiai Trendek
Cloud Integráció
A felhő technológiák térnyerésével a hagyományos quorum disk koncepciók is fejlődnek. A cloud-native megoldások új lehetőségeket kínálnak a quorum mechanizmusok implementálására, beleértve a managed szolgáltatásokat és a serverless architektúrákat.
A hibrid felhő környezetek különleges kihívásokat jelentenek a quorum disk tervezése szempontjából. A helyszíni és felhőbeli erőforrások közötti kapcsolat megbízhatósága kritikus fontosságú a stabil működés érdekében.
A multi-cloud stratégiák esetében a quorum mechanizmusok több felhőszolgáltató között is működnie kell. Ez új szintű komplexitást és tervezési kihívásokat hoz magával.
Konténer Technológiák
A konténerizált alkalmazások és a Kubernetes orkesztrációs platform új megközelítést igényelnek a quorum mechanizmusok terén. Az etcd és hasonló elosztott kulcs-érték tárolók átvesznek bizonyos quorum funkciókat.
A mikroszolgáltatás architektúrák esetében a hagyományos klaszter quorum koncepciók kevésbé relevánsak, de az elosztott döntéshozatal igénye továbbra is fennáll. Az új technológiák, mint a Raft konsenzus algoritmus, alternatív megoldásokat kínálnak.
Mesterséges Intelligencia és Automatizáció
Az AI és ML technológiák integrációja a quorum menedzsmentbe lehetővé teszi a prediktív karbantartást és az automatizált optimalizálást. A rendszerek képesek lesznek előre jelezni a potenciális problémákat és automatikusan alkalmazkodni a változó körülményekhez.
Az automatizált helyreállítási mechanizmusok csökkentik az emberi beavatkozás szükségességét és gyorsítják a hibakezelési folyamatokat. Ez különösen értékes nagy léptékű környezetekben, ahol a manuális kezelés nem praktikus.
Mi az a cluster quorum disk?
A cluster quorum disk egy speciális tárolóeszköz, amely döntéshozatali mechanizmusként funkcionál klaszter környezetekben. Biztosítja, hogy a klaszter csomópontok közötti konfliktusok esetén egyértelmű döntés szülessen a működés folytatásáról.
Miért szükséges quorum disk használata?
A quorum disk megakadályozza a "split-brain" szituációt, amikor a klaszter különböző részei egymástól függetlenül próbálnak működni. Ez kritikus fontosságú a data integritás és a szolgáltatás kontinuitás biztosítása szempontjából.
Milyen típusú tárolót használjak quorum diskként?
Magas rendelkezésre állású, redundáns tárolórendszert érdemes választani. SAN környezetben FC vagy iSCSI kapcsolattal, RAID 1 vagy RAID 10 konfigurációval. A méret általában 512 MB – 1 GB közötti elegendő.
Hány quorum disk szükséges egy klaszterhez?
Általában egyetlen quorum disk elegendő klaszterenként. Azonban a magas rendelkezésre állás érdekében érdemes redundáns tárolórendszert használni, amely automatikusan biztosítja a szükséges hibatűrést.
Mi történik, ha a quorum disk meghibásodik?
A quorum disk hibája esetén a klaszter működése a konfigurált quorum típustól függ. Node and Disk Majority esetén a klaszter továbbműködhet, ha elegendő csomópont elérhető. Disk Only quorum esetén a klaszter leáll.
Hogyan monitorozhatom a quorum disk állapotát?
Használjon klaszter menedzsment eszközöket, rendszeresen ellenőrizze az eseménynaplókat, és állítson be automatikus riasztásokat. Figyelje a tárolóeszköz válaszidejét, I/O hibákat és a hálózati kapcsolatok állapotát.
